The Gabon levulinic acid market serves industries such as biofuel, pharmaceuticals, and cosmetics. Its role as a green chemical alternative aligns with global trends toward sustainable and eco-friendly practices.
The Gabon levulinic acid market is fueled by its wide application in the production of bio-based chemicals, pharmaceuticals, and personal care products. Growing demand for sustainable and renewable alternatives to petrochemical-based products significantly supports market growth.
The levulinic acid market faces limited adoption due to its niche applications and low awareness of its potential benefits. Challenges also include the unavailability of feedstocks and limited investment in chemical processing infrastructure.
The Gabonese government supports the levulinic acid market as part of its broader sustainability goals. Policies encourage the production and use of bio-based chemicals through grants and incentives for green technology adoption. Research and development initiatives aim to position Gabon as a regional hub for bio-chemicals.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
